Winter Athletes named to All-American Team
Greg Miller, Staff Writer
14 different Auggie student athletes were awarded with All American honors as either a member of the first, second or third team, or as an honorable mention.
Senior basketball player Booker Coplin was awarded d3hoops.com All-America men’s basketball honors for the second straight year when he was named to this season’s All-America Honorable Mention team. Coplin led the MIAC in Points Per Game with 23.7, as well as being top five in many other statistical categories. Coplin was also named to the DIII Recess All Star team.
Senior hockey player Nikki Nightengale was also named to her second straight All-America team, making the second team again, a first in team history. She became the fifth Augsburg Women’s hockey player to ever be named to an All American team. Nightengale was second in the MIAC in both assists and points by a defender.
Women’s wrestling had four All-America honorees in its inaugural season including two-time National Champion Emily Shilson. Gabby Skidmore (6th place at nationals), Vayle-Rae Baker (6th place at nationals) and Marlynne Deede (6th place at nationals) joined Shilson as the first Women’s wrestlers to be named to the All American team.
